About this role

The Quality and Patient Safety Specialist supports the organization in advancing high‑reliability and a culture of safety. Under general supervision, this role provides leadership, guidance, and subject‑matter expertise to clinical and operational teams to ensure compliance with policies, accreditation standards, and patient safety requirements. In general, the specialist oversees and/or facilitates quality and patient safety activities, including safety event review and analysis, performance improvement initiatives, Comprehensive Systematic Analyses, and physician peer review coordination. Education: Bachelor's degree in nursing; Master's degree preferred Experience: At least 3 years' experience in a Joint Commission accredited hospital or other similar healthcare environment.…
